How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mission Canyon?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mission Canyon Studio Apartments | $3,737 | $2,250 | $5,225 |
| Mission Canyon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,833 | $2,525 | $2,995 |
| Mission Canyon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,879 | $3,483 | $4,875 |
Mission Canyon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,883 | $2,100 | $4,950 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
